Clarification on 'GETINFO exit-policy/*'s valid 'non-transient internal errors'

Hi network team. I was just about to tweak Stem to treat 552 GETINFO response codes as "I'm not configured to be a relay" per...

https://trac.torproject.org/projects/tor/ticket/25853 https://trac.torproject.org/projects/tor/ticket/25852 https://gitweb.torproject.org/torspec.git/commit/?id=c5453a0

However, the spec addition says "Will send 552 error if the server is not running as nion router or if there's non-transient internal error." So I'm unsure what the response code actually indicates. If we are a relay that what are the scenarios where tor validly returns a 552?

For now in stem gonna pretend that part doesn't exist and 552s indicate 'not a relay'. :)
